The Business English Certificate Program (4 or 8 weeks) and Diploma Program (12 weeks) are designed to provide students with market competitiveness and to develop skills needed to work effectively in today's business world. The program consists of business concepts which are supported with Internet research, team building activities, dynamic participation and critical thinking. Throughout the course students develop their writing styles and interpret business articles, company reports and case studies. The media is also a key component of this comprehensive program. Students will be analyzing different forms of the media and stress is placed on being aware of current business issues in the market place. Omnicom Business English students also participate in Business Seminars and workshops to experience first hand the Canadian corporate structure.
The BEC Preparation component of our Business English Programs was added to meet the growing demand for language tests with a specialised focus. Authentic business communications, including emails, memos, and telephone conversations, are used to reinforce all three sections of the Cambridge test: Reading / Writing, Listening, and Speaking. Test tips and sample questions will allow students to prepare themselves for the challenges of the BEC Preliminary Exam.

 

Course Requirements:

TOEIC score of 660, or TOEFL score of 152 CBT, 475 PBT, 50 iBT, or Upper-intermediate level placement test, OR successful completion of Level 10, Omnicom Intensive English Program

Age requirements:

Over 18

Length of study:


4, 8 or 12 weeks, 25 hours/week
